  • Central Serous Chorioretinopathy in Pregnancy. OS-IR

    Dec 31 2020 by Cosimo Antonio Calabro

    Woman (37-years-old) in pregnancy (third trimester). Central serous chorioretinopathy in both eyes. The return to normal occurred spontaneously after 8 months. The IR image refers to the OS: at the rear pole, the central area appears gray (these are the boundaries of the "bubble"). Its lower part appears even more gray due to the Transudate which, by gravity, concentrates on it
